FluxoTotal Posted August 5, 2019 Posted August 5, 2019 Ola glr do forum, boa tarde. continuando aki meus estudos em script .Lua para o mta . tenho uma pergunta , quando eu entro em um site da mta para pegar as referencia para os comandos eles estao assim: vehicle createVehicle ( int model, float x, float y, float z [, float rx, float ry, float rz, string numberplate, bool bDirection, int variant1, int variant2 ] ) queria saber se tipo , se eu nao quiser colocar por exemplo o string numberplate , porem quero colocar o bool bdirection . como faço para pula o anterior para por o proximo?
androksi Posted August 5, 2019 Posted August 5, 2019 Você tem duas opções: não usar o parâmetro ou pulá-lo. Acho que é melhor eu responder a sua pergunta. Faça deste jeito: addCommandHandler('veh', function(player) local x, y, z = getElementPosition(player) vehicle = createVehicle(411, x, y, z, _, _, _, 'ABC-1337') end ) Na situação acima, suponhamos que você queira apenas criar o veículo com uma placa diferente. Porém, antes do parâmetro da placa, você tem 3 outros parâmetros: Rotação X, Rotação Y e Rotação Z. Para ignorar, basta adicionar um underline (_), como no exemplo acima. 1 Hello, world. Tutorial sobre interação de BOTs do Discord com o seu servidor - Visitar (Brazilian Portuguese) Tutorial sobre tabelas - Visitar (Brazilian Portuguese) Tutorial sobre banco de dados - Visitar (Brazilian Portuguese)
DNL291 Posted August 5, 2019 Posted August 5, 2019 3 hours ago, FluxoTotal said: se eu nao quiser colocar por exemplo o string numberplate , porem quero colocar o bool bdirection . Setando false ou nil provavelmente irá "ignorar" o argumento e a numberplate vai ser gerada por padrão. O underline mostrado no código do asrzkj ele pode ser usado. Ali na verdade é como se você tivesse colocado um nil já que não há uma referência definida para esse valor. Você pode também simplesmente definir o valor que já será o padrão, pois ali nas rotações o padrão será 0. Please do not PM me with scripting related question nor support, use the forums instead.
Moderators Lord Henry Posted August 6, 2019 Moderators Posted August 6, 2019 Eu geralmente uso os valores padrão pra evitar erros. Eu te ajudei ou achou meu comentário útil? Não esqueça de deixar um Thanks! Minhas contribuições para a comunidade: LordHenry - MTA Wiki Profile Inscreva-se no meu canal do YouTube: Lord Henry - Entertainment Discord Oficial do MTA: https://mtasa.com/discord Blacklist e Whitelist de Scripters: Planilha Por favor, não me envie mensagens privadas solicitando suporte. Crie um tópico no fórum em vez disso.
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now